#23675c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23675c is composed of 13.7% red, 40.4%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 170.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 27.1%. #23675c color hex could be obtained by blending #46ceb8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#23675c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23675c has RGB values of R:35, G:103,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2320220.

Shades and Tints of #23675c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23675c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434746 is the less saturated color, while #038772 is the most saturated one.
